A Variable Optical Attenuator (VOA) is an essential component in fiber optic communication systems. It is designed to manage the optical power level of signals, ensuring that light intensity at the receiver remains within the ideal range. What Is an Optical Circulator? An Optical Circulator is a non-reciprocal passive device used in fiber optic communication systems to control the direction of light propagation.
